Vendor Rules
4-H Building
• No use of duct tape on the floors, walls, columns, etc.
Please use approved tape only.
Approved tape must be
purchased from ISF.
• All doors except designated entry doors will be locked during show hours. No
vendors or general public will be allowed in through non-approved doors and we
discourage you from exiting from these doors unless in the case of an emergency.
• No loading in or out through the glass walk-through doors at any time.
Overhead doors will be locked approximately half an hour before opening. After
that your load in will need to take place at the South East overhead door.
• During show hours, large items purchased must be loaded out through the South
East overhead door or dock doors. No other overhead door will be accessible
during show hours.
• If you are driving a vehicle in during load in or load out please make sure it
is not muddy, covered in snow, or wet. Absolutely no vehicles are allowed to be
moving during a show. Vehicles are not allowed in the building once the show has
begun and restocks must take place at the South East overhead door.
• Service animals only. Please clean up after all animals.
• We encourage no tear-down prior to close of the event. Do not line up your
vehicles until 30 minutes before show close. Vehicles are not allowed in the
building until permitted by ISF staff.
• No outside food or beverage may be brought in the building within 30 minutes
of the show start time. Bottled water is allowed.
• Please pay attention to all parking signs. If you are parked illegally, you
will be towed.
For the preservation of our property and safety of our guests, the Iowa State
Fair has the right to enforce all rules. Failure to follow these rules could
result in immediate expulsion. We thank you in advance for your cooperation.

Iowa Metaphysical Fair Contract
No set up until contract has been reviewed and signed by vendor.
DO NOT ENTER BUILDING BEFORE 4:00 p.m. FRIDAY. (There are many reasons for this rule)
Be mindful about set up and tear down times. Set up Friday 4pm-8pm Tear down Sunday 6pm-10:30pm
Please be set up by 10:30 Sat. morning and be at the circle if possible. Lots of info given at circle.
Absolutely no early tear down before Sunday at 6pm. You may not be invited back.
No one is guaranteed a specific spot. You may request; we will do our best to accommodate you.
11am-closing no door except front ticket doors will be used. With exception of IMF board and emergencies. This is for everyone’s protection.
Per fire code all cords must not cross any walkway and must be taped down (with painter’s tape only Blue). You will be unplugged if you do not comply. There is a $40.00 fee if you use electrical outlet without paying so just pay before you plug in. DO NOT ASK NEIGHBOR TO LEND YOU ELECTRIC.
No music allowed except for healing purposes. This must be set at a reasonable volume.
No incense or open flames allowed. NO Smoking except outside in designated area.
Park all trailers and vehicles in designated area. Keep parking lot open for vendors unless handicapped.
Be respectful to all vendors, Specifically, those on either side of you. Negative comments toward other vendors are not permitted. We encourage a safe and positive fair.
If you are experiencing an issue, please locate the Fair Manager to address the problem.
The behavior of your staff reflects you and you are responsible for them. They are expected to understand and follow all rules outlined in your contract as well.
All children must be accompanied by an adult, or they must stay in your booth. You are responsible for all monetary damages that may occur by unsupervised children.
No endorsing of other healers or readers outside your booth.
No soliciting any other vendor during fair. We have had too many complaints.
The list you submit of types of healings and readings are all you are allowed to practice at the fair. Any added modalities must be screened. If you do a reading or healing without screening you will pack up and leave the building immediately. NO EXCEPTIONS. Readers and healers must get approved if adding product to booth as well.
Do not start a reading or healing that goes past closing times.
Any damages caused by you, or your staff will be your responsibility to pay for in full.
For all updates and notices go to www.iametaphysicalfair.com/vendorspage.htm. It’s your responsibility to keep yourself updated.
By signing this contract, I agree to all rules and conditions set forth by the IMF, State Fairgrounds, and Fire Marshall. I understand that failure to comply can result in dismissal without refund and jeopardizes future opportunities with this organization.
